【jdk配置环境变量配置】在Java开发过程中,正确配置JDK的环境变量是确保Java程序能够正常运行和编译的关键步骤。本文将对JDK环境变量的配置进行简要总结,并通过表格形式清晰展示各变量的作用及设置方法。
一、JDK环境变量配置概述
JDK(Java Development Kit)是Java开发的核心工具包,包含Java编译器(javac)、Java虚拟机(java)以及各种开发工具。为了使系统能够识别并使用这些工具,需要将JDK安装路径添加到系统的环境变量中。
常见的环境变量包括:
- JAVA_HOME:指定JDK的安装目录。
- PATH:告诉系统在哪里查找可执行文件(如java、javac)。
- CLASSPATH(可选):用于指定Java类库的搜索路径。
二、JDK环境变量配置步骤(Windows系统)
环境变量名称 | 设置值示例 | 说明 |
JAVA_HOME | C:\Program Files\Java\jdk-17.0.3 | 指定JDK的安装路径 |
PATH | %JAVA_HOME%\bin;... | 将JDK的bin目录加入系统路径,以便直接调用javac/java等命令 |
CLASSPATH | .;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ar | 可选,用于指定类库路径 |
> 注意:在Windows系统中,用户需根据实际安装路径修改上述值。
三、验证配置是否成功
1. 打开命令提示符(CMD)。
2. 输入以下命令查看Java版本:
```
java -version
javac -version
```
3. 若显示正确的Java版本信息,则表示配置成功。
四、常见问题与解决方法
问题 | 原因 | 解决方法 |
java 命令无法识别 | 环境变量未正确设置或PATH未更新 | 检查JAVA_HOME和PATH配置,重启终端 |
多个JDK版本冲突 | 系统中存在多个JDK安装路径 | 删除旧版本或调整PATH顺序 |
编译报错找不到类 | CLASSPATH未正确设置 | 检查CLASSPATH是否包含必要的jar包 |
五、总结
配置JDK的环境变量是Java开发的基础操作之一,虽然步骤简单,但一旦出错可能影响整个开发流程。建议在安装JDK后立即完成环境变量的设置,并通过命令行验证配置是否生效。对于初学者而言,保持环境变量的简洁和准确非常重要,避免不必要的错误和混淆。
以上内容为原创总结,旨在帮助开发者快速掌握JDK环境变量的配置方法。